Next stop: Grant's Farm, owned by the Anheuser Busch Company (which was bought by Embev over a year ago, so we are not sure how much longer the new company will hold on to this gem). It opened in 1954, and Dad and I realized that our family has been coming here since before 1973. I have so many good memories of Grant's Farm, and I hope that our kids will too.
